Comparable Facts
Compare Paine College in Augusta, GA with Grace School of Theology in Conroe, TX on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
Grace School of Theology is larger than Paine College based on total student enrollment (568 students vs. 390 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Paine College is located in Augusta, GA (Midsize City setting); Grace School of Theology is in Conroe, TX (Midsize City setting).
- Paine College is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. Grace School of Theology is a private,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Paine College 11:1; Grace School of Theology 12:1.
Paine College vs. Grace School of Theology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Paine College or Grace School of Theology?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Paine College are 56.5% lower than at Grace School of Theology ($7,512 vs. $17,280).
- Paine College is 89.1% more expensive for in-state tuition than Grace School of Theology (about $6,876 more per year; $14,596.00 vs. $7,720.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 89.1% higher at Paine College than at Grace School of Theology (about $6,876 more per year; $14,596.00 vs. $7,720.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Paine College than at Grace School of Theology (100% vs. 0%).
